Characterization of Banach-space-valued functions involving the Weinstein transform

Santosh Kumar Upadhyay, Sitaram Yadav

Abstract


In this paper, the space H(A) is defined by exploiting the theory of the Weinstein transform, and proved that Weinstein transform F_w(phi) is an automorphism on the space H(A). The Banach space-valued test functions of Beurling type ultradistribution H_{omeg}(A) is defined by taking the weight function omega. It is
shown that the subspace D^{Rn+1}_{+}(A) is dense in H_{omga}(A) and the Weinstein transform Fw(phi) is an automorphism on the space H_{omega}(A). Further showed that the linear space omega D^{Rn+1}_{+}(A) oplus (A) is dense in H_{omrga}(A).
